& Communications Senior Business Development Manager - 12m Senior Business Development Manager - Transactional practice Location..., ignore this field Create alert You agree to our Share this job Senior Business Development Manager - 12m City...
about our business is paramount, and our open and transparent culture means you'll have direct access to experts and senior leaders via...Customer Success Manager - German & English speaker Location: London, United Kingdom / Dublin, Ireland Contract...
Senior Project Manager to join their growing Project Management team. Each Senior Project Manager in the company are given... the support to focus solely on Project Delivery, while having the scope to immerse themselves in business development...
team-building activities. About The Role As a Senior Product Manager at Paired, you will own the Connection pillar... is the #1 couples app globally with +12M downloads, +250,000 daily active users, and more than £5M of fundraising...